Tony Caduto wrote: > The easiest solution is just not to use caps or spaces in your > table/object names, there is no advantage to doing so. > People just need to get over the fact that having caps in a name make it > easier to read. > > My Test Table should be my_test_table, the naming makes no difference > to the application using the table. > > Same thing with ordering of fields in a table, it makes no difference > other than for looks if the fields are in the order you want them > to be in. > > It is much more of a pain to qoute your sql than it is to have it look > nice. > > Just my 2 cents on the subject. > The problem we have is that we want to migrate to postgresql from our current sql server db, but the problem with caps requiring quotes around them makes this a far from easy migration.
